_ . Ann Aiibor, Feb. 5, 1847. The price of Flour in England, as brought by steamer, was 37s. to 38s. in bond, which would net in New York about $7,25. A great excüement took place among déniers, and sales were made at $6,25 to JOO, at the rate of 15,000 to 30,000 barrels a day. Com vaB active at 80 to 85 ets. By the last advices from New York, we learn that Michigan flour was selling at6,75a 86,87é. Genesee at $7, with privilege of storage and payment, The price of wlieat to-day in this village ranges from 61 to 62i cents. - -i- i -
